Usando MySQL Set Select Into Variable Para Mejorar Su Programación SQL
En el mundo de la programación SQL, encontrar formas de hacer el código más eficiente y eficaz puede ser la clave para el éxito. Una técnica útil para lograr esto es el uso del comando SET SELECT INTO VARIABLE en MySQL. Este comando permite a los desarrolladores almacenar el resultado de una consulta SELECT en una variable, lo que permite una mayor flexibilidad y control en el código SQL. En este artículo, exploraremos cómo usar SET SELECT INTO VARIABLE en MySQL para mejorar la programación SQL y ahorrar tiempo y esfuerzo.
Aprende a asignar valores a variables en SQL mediante la función SELECT
Uno de los beneficios de utilizar variables en SQL es que se pueden asignar valores para utilizarlos más adelante en el código. La función SELECT es la que permite la asignación de valores a variables en SQL.
La sintaxis de la asignación de valores mediante la función SELECT es la siguiente:
SELECT @variable = columna FROM tabla WHERE condición
Donde @variable es el nombre de la variable, columna es el nombre de la columna de la tabla en la que se está buscando el valor y tabla es el nombre de la tabla de la que se está extrayendo el valor.
Guía para usar MySQL Shared MemoryEs importante destacar que la condición se utiliza para encontrar el valor que se desea asignar a la variable específica.
Otro ejemplo de asignación de valores a variables mediante la función SELECT podría ser:
SELECT @nombre = nombre, @apellido = apellido FROM usuarios WHERE id = 1
En este caso, se están asignando los valores de la columna 'nombre' y 'apellido' de la tabla 'usuarios' a las variables '@nombre' y '@apellido', respectivamente. La condición 'WHERE id = 1' se utiliza para encontrar el valor específico que se desea asignar a las variables.
La asignación de valores a variables mediante la función SELECT es muy útil en SQL ya que permite almacenar y utilizar valores en el código de forma más eficiente y organizada.
Reflexión
En conclusión, la función SELECT es esencial para asignar valores a variables en SQL. La utilización de variables puede simplificar y hacer más eficiente el código, lo que puede ser fundamental para un buen funcionamiento de un sistema. ¿Qué otros beneficios consideras que pueden tener las variables en SQL? ¡Comparte tu opinión en los comentarios!
Mostrar procesos en MySQL de todos los usuarios - Título SEO corto con la palabra clave mysql show processlist all users.Descubre cómo funciona el poderoso comando SELECT de MySQL para recuperar datos eficientemente
El comando SELECT de MySQL es una herramienta muy importante para recuperar datos eficientemente de una base de datos. Permite seleccionar y mostrar información específica de una tabla o varias tablas relacionadas.
SELECT se utiliza en combinación con otras cláusulas como FROM, WHERE, ORDER BY, GROUP BY, entre otras.
La cláusula FROM indica la(s) tabla(s) de la que se seleccionarán los datos. Es posible escribir JOIN para unir varias tablas y obtener información relacionada.
La cláusula WHERE permite establecer una o varias condiciones para seleccionar datos específicos, como por ejemplo, mostrar solo aquellos registros que cumplan con un cierto criterio.
La cláusula ORDER BY permite ordenar los resultados por una o varias columnas, ya sea en orden ascendente o descendente.
Filtrar el Proceso de Visualización en MySQL: Tutorial de MySQL Show Processlist FilterLa cláusula GROUP BY permite agrupar los resultados por una o varias columnas y también puede trabajar en conjunto con funciones de agregación como COUNT, SUM, AVG, entre otras.
Además, es posible utilizar la cláusula LIMIT para establecer una cantidad máxima de registros a mostrar. Esto es especialmente útil cuando se trabaja con grandes cantidades de datos.
En resumen, el comando SELECT es una herramienta muy poderosa que permite recuperar datos de forma eficiente y personalizada. Al conocer las diferentes cláusulas que se pueden utilizar en combinación, es posible manipular los resultados de manera efectiva y obtener la información deseada de manera rápida y sencilla.
Ahora que ya conoces un poco más sobre cómo funciona este comando de MySQL, ¿qué otras cláusulas o funciones crees que podrían ser útiles para la recuperación de datos? Te animamos a seguir profundizando en el tema y descubrir lo que este poderoso comando puede hacer por ti y tu trabajo.
Secretos para optimizar el rendimiento de tu base de datos MySQL
MySQL es uno de los sistemas de gestión de bases de datos más populares y ampliamente utilizados. Sin embargo, para garantizar un rendimiento óptimo y una gestión eficiente de los datos, es esencial conocer algunos secretos que ayudarán a mejorar el funcionamiento de tu base de datos.
Uno de los aspectos más importantes para tener una base de datos MySQL eficiente es la optimización de consultas. Asegúrate de utilizar índices y claves externas correctamente y de evitar el uso excesivo de subconsultas.
Otro factor clave en el rendimiento de tu base de datos es la configuración. Ajusta la memoria caché y el tamaño de los buffers según las necesidades de tu sistema y asegúrate de tener configurados los parámetros de conexión y tiempo de espera correctamente.
Para hacer frente a posibles problemas de fragmentación, realiza regularmente defragmentaciones de tablas y utiliza la opción "OPTIMIZE TABLE" para mejorar el rendimiento general.
Finalmente, es importante realizar copias de seguridad de manera regular y programada, para evitar la pérdida de datos y configuración, y así tener una estrategia de recuperación a tiempo de los problemas técnicos que puedan surgir.
En definitiva, aplicando estos secretos para optimizar el rendimiento de tu base de datos MySQL, podrás gestionar tus datos eficientemente y obtener resultados más rápidos y confiables. ¿Conoces algún otro secreto para optimizar el rendimiento de tu base de datos?
En conclusión, usar MySQL set select into variable puede mejorar significativamente su programación SQL al permitirle manejar de manera más eficiente los resultados de sus consultas.
Esperamos que este artículo haya sido útil para usted y lo inspire a explorar aún más las muchas capacidades de MySQL.
¡Hasta pronto!
Si quieres conocer otros artículos parecidos a Usando MySQL Set Select Into Variable Para Mejorar Su Programación SQL puedes visitar la categoría Informática.
Deja una respuesta
Aprende mas sobre MySQL